I’ve been fighting with IE over the past three days to complete the new IPS rich text editor.
I’ve decided to merge the two editors into one OOP JS file which has a lot more code re-use and is much more efficient. The new RTE loads almost instantly compared to the current IPB one which takes a few seconds to initialize.
I won’t bore you to death why it took three days to write (not least because of irritiating differences between IE and FF which mean you’re effectively writing two editors) and I won’t blather on about the cool new features which include the floating palettes and extensibility.
Instead, I’ll show you a movie.
(Note, there is no AJAX in the RTE currently. The little palettes are DOM styled and wrapped iFrames. I could have used AJAX, but the iFrames are more suitable for this application. I prefer to use the right tool for the job. After all, just because we’ve bought a new hammer, it doesn’t mean we have to use it to bash screws into the wall).
IPD New RTE ( 2.3mb Quicktime .mov )
19 comments
Comments feed for this article
December 7, 2005 at 5:44 pm
Korak
Wow! That’s the best looking rich text editor I’ve ever seen in a CMS.
Great work!!
December 7, 2005 at 5:57 pm
Tim Dorr
Pretty spiffy.
December 7, 2005 at 6:18 pm
Andy
How does the RTE handle images Matt or have you not got that far yet? For me the article manager is the most eagerly anticipated function of the CMS and I’m curious to its’ functionality. Would you be ale to expand on its’ feature-set further?
Great work on the editor so far, I particularly like the way the editor retains the state of text formatting. Most other inline editors I have worked with require the formatting to be added as an afterthought, usually by selecting the text after writing and then applying the formatting.
December 7, 2005 at 6:38 pm
rollercoaster375
That’s absolutely incredible.
I can’t wait to actually demo it =D
December 7, 2005 at 6:38 pm
Matt
I miiiiight be able to squeeze in an “Insert Image -> Upload” function into the RTE before IPD v1 is released.
If not, you can add images from around the web via the “Insert Image” palette or use the “Insert IPD Tag” and choose an already uploaded image.
December 7, 2005 at 6:45 pm
James
That’s a pretty damned amazing RTE.
December 7, 2005 at 7:00 pm
Myr
Wow! That looks great! I can’t wait to start giving this thing a test drive.
December 7, 2005 at 7:19 pm
Max
Matt, I want to make sure you remember that us webmasters like to get access to the code while composing in RTE’s. Also, how do you add images? It’s very important to get the thumbnails of images from a directory when adding images to content.
Other then that, looking good!!
December 7, 2005 at 7:27 pm
Wilko
I cant believe how much better it looks, you’ve really outdone yourself haha.
Hopefully you will be porting it to IPB some time soon? before 3.0?
The more you show of this CMS the more I want it.
December 7, 2005 at 7:32 pm
Jonas
Looks absolutly amazing. But please please include the feature to limit the formating of text to a fixed set of styles. Not all users can handle the responsability that comes whith free choise of font and color. ;o)
December 7, 2005 at 7:37 pm
Andy
Yes but unfortunately the more he show’s of this CMS the more we WANT out of it
I’m looking forward to putting this product through its’ paces. I was also wondering whether the source was accessible like Max pointed out.
December 7, 2005 at 7:47 pm
Don Wilson
I don’t really care for the icons, but nonetheless, very nice.
December 8, 2005 at 12:54 am
David
Pretty cool.
December 8, 2005 at 11:16 am
Fabien
Pretty work !!!
December 9, 2005 at 4:33 am
Dean Clatworthy
Kudos Matt, this looks absolutely great.
December 10, 2005 at 1:22 am
Brandon
Damn, Matt, that’s oh so svelte and sexy.
April 11, 2006 at 12:24 am
Casey
Hey Matt,
I just stumbled across this page looking for a text editor. Your rich text editor looks amazing. Don’t know anything about your work but I was just wondering if it’ll be available for public release anytime soon and on what platform. Thanks.
- Casey
September 24, 2008 at 3:37 am
tayh
thinks
http://www.توبيكات.com
September 24, 2008 at 3:40 am
خواطر
very nice
thinks…….
http://www.tnahid.com/vb